Anyone know of anyplace (other than the dealer) that might be able to do BCM firmware updates? Bench flashed or through the OBDII port? I've got an early 2019 2500 that I've used AlfaOBD to add several factory options to. Unfortunately though there's new features coming out now that I'd like to be able to enable in my BCM like Trailer light check, and Offroad pages in the Uconnect, but my BCM firmware is too dated and doesn't support these new features.

Seeing as I highly doubt the BCM has had any hardware changes since 2019, these new features on newer trucks (21+) have to be available because they were added with new firmware versions.

At the moment my only lead is Infotainment.com offers replacement BCM's with what they claim to be "The latest and Greatest" updated firmware. I reached out to them to ask some questions about the service because if I absolutely had to I wouldn't be opposed to buying an updated BCM IF I knew it would add the features I'm after. I also asked if they'd be willing to offer an update service for a lesser price. They didn't respond to my e-mail so I'm at a dead end right now.

Wasn't able to get anywhere on either option. It seems the dealer is the only one that can do module updates. Also for whatever reason the 4.5 gen HD's don't allow you to swap BCM's easily like the 4th gens do.
